Mouana Koh Kaew is a development of 3–4 bedroom pool villas, 261–332 sqm, by developer Mouana Phuket Property Development, in the inland Koh Kaew district near Boat Lagoon and Royal Phuket Marina. Every villa has a private pool, and the developer states a phased handover — part of the units by the end of 2025, with the final phase by October 2026.
Koh Kaew is a district in the center of the island’s east coast, built up mostly with gated villa and condo communities around Boat Lagoon and Royal Phuket Marina rather than beach infrastructure: it’s about 13 km to Bang Tao and 15 km to Patong. The format suits a buyer who values proximity to the marinas, international schools and the airport over a walk to the sea. The projected rental yield per the developer’s estimate is around 6% per year — above the catalog’s average benchmark for this segment; like any marketing projection, it’s worth verifying against actual occupancy rather than treating it as a guarantee in your calculations. The developer has not disclosed installment-plan terms as of publication.
Mouana Phuket Property Development has been on the island for more than 17 years and claims a portfolio of 20+ completed projects, including other Mouana series in Chalong and Mai Khao — a real track record, not just marketing promises. That said, independent sources diverge on details specific to the Mouana Koh Kaew project itself — phased handover dates and the exact number of villas in the complex — so we don’t publish an averaged figure and instead verify the status of a specific unit directly before reservation. The developer, for its part, confirms a phased handover: 2025 for the first phases, 2026 for the final one.

The developer information in this listing states: freehold / leasehold. This is the project-level starting point, not a legal opinion on a particular unit. The contract, title, foreign quota and seller authority must be verified before reservation.
A foreign-quota condominium is registered in the buyer’s name. Purchase funds must enter Thailand with the correct purpose so the receiving bank can issue the foreign-exchange evidence used at the Land Office.
A foreign buyer may own the structure but cannot directly own Thai land. The land element is normally held through a registered long lease or another lawful structure. Term, renewals, inheritance and resale rights must be explicit in the contract.
Verify the receiving legal entity, construction milestone, payment trigger, delay remedies and the documents the seller must deliver for registration.
This is general information. Structure and taxes depend on the unit, seller and contract; an independent Thai lawyer should complete the final review.

Funds arrive from abroad in foreign currency and the Thai bank issues an FET form. Without it the Land Department will not register freehold to a foreigner, so we agree the amount and payment reference in advance.
